DigitalXForce, a a global leader in AI-powered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C), Enterprise Security Risk Posture Management (ESRPM), and AI Trust, Risk, and Security Management (AI TRiSM), today announced accelerating market momentum as the company advances toward its long-term goal of reaching $100 million in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) over the next 2 to 3 years.

X-ROC™ Driving the Next Era of Risk Operations
At the center of DigitalXForce’s platform is X-ROC™, the company’s AI-powered Risk Operations Center designed to operationalize cyber, compliance, AI, and third-party risk in real time.
X-ROC™ continuously ingests telemetry from 250+ security, IT, cloud, and enterprise platforms, enabling organizations to:
• Monitor enterprise risk posture continuously
• Correlate cyber, AI, compliance, and operational risk signals
• Prioritize remediation using AI-driven intelligence
• Provide executives and boards with real-time risk visibility
• Move from reactive compliance to proactive risk governance
By transforming risk into an operational capability, DigitalXForce is positioning itself as a next-generation alternative to traditional GRC and fragmented security tooling.
